Embarking on a DIY drone project can be a truly thrilling endeavor, offering a unique blend of technology, creativity, and innovation. However, successfully managing such a project requires a strategic approach that incorporates key project management principles and elements of diplomacy. In this blog post, we will explore how to effectively navigate the skies with your DIY drone project through the lens of project management diplomacy. 1. Setting Clear Objectives: Before delving into the technicalities of building a DIY drone, it is essential to establish clear project objectives. Define the purpose of your drone, identify the desired features, and outline the scope of the project. This initial step sets the foundation for effective project management and ensures that everyone involved is aligned towards a common goal. 2. Stakeholder Engagement: In project management, stakeholder engagement is crucial for success. Identify key stakeholders, such as team members, sponsors, end-users, and regulatory authorities, and involve them throughout the project lifecycle. Effective communication and collaboration with stakeholders can help mitigate risks, address concerns, and enhance the overall project outcome. 3. Risk Management: Building a DIY drone involves inherent risks, ranging from technical challenges to safety and regulatory issues. Implement a robust risk management strategy that identifies potential risks, assesses their impact and likelihood, and develops mitigation plans. By proactively managing risks, you can minimize disruptions and keep your project on track. 4. Resource Allocation: Successful project management requires efficient resource allocation. Determine the resources needed for your DIY drone project, including materials, tools, and human resources. Allocate resources effectively, considering factors such as budget constraints, time constraints, and skill levels. Balancing resources ensures smooth project execution and timely delivery. 5. Adaptability and Flexibility: Flexibility is key to navigating the uncertainties of a DIY drone project. Be prepared to adapt to changing circumstances, unexpected challenges, and evolving requirements. Embrace a flexible project management approach that allows for adjustments while staying focused on the ultimate project goals. 6. Compliance and Regulation: When working on a DIY drone project, it is essential to adhere to relevant regulations and safety standards. Stay informed about local drone regulations, licensing requirements, and airspace restrictions. Compliance with regulations not only ensures legal adherence but also promotes responsible drone operation and public safety. In conclusion, combining DIY drone projects with project management diplomacy can lead to successful project outcomes and a rewarding experience. By setting clear objectives, engaging stakeholders, managing risks, allocating resources wisely, fostering adaptability, and upholding compliance, you can navigate the skies with confidence and achieve your drone project goals.
